#e86ff6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e86ff6 is composed of 91% red, 43.5%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.7% cyan, 54.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 293.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 70%. #e86ff6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deff with #d100ed.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

Shades and Tints of #e86ff6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030004 is the darkest color, while #fdf0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e86ff6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b0b5 is the less saturated color, while #ed69fc is the most saturated one.
